Has the ‘tradwives’ bubble burst?

Model and influencer Nara Smith has spoken out against being called a "tradwife" in a recent episode of the Call Her Daddy podcast. Smith, known for her social media recipes in high-end dresses, disputes the term, which she says doesn't apply to her. According to her research, a tradwife prioritizes family and household care, supports her husband as primary breadwinner, and values traditional gender roles in marriage. Smith argues her own life doesn't match this definition.
